Fancybox and Transparency

Fancybox and Transparency

本文关键字:Transparency and Fancybox      更新时间:2023-09-26

我会尽力解释的。=>

我正在使用fanybox,一切都很好。问题来了。我有一个半透明的图像。当图像被加载时,而不是看到图像所在的背景的一部分,而是有一个背景颜色。有没有一种方法可以让背景(图像后面)是透明的?我指的不是覆盖层。我指的是图像的正后方。

感谢所有的帮助和建议。

下面是Fancybox的代码:
<script type="text/javascript" >
   var $j = jQuery.noConflict();
    $j(document).ready(function(){
        Engine.Initialize(); //This line is for other JS - not fancybox
    $j("#start").fancybox({
     'padding' : 0
    });
  });
</script>

这是我所指的截图。

编辑 更新了自发布以来我对页面所做的一些更改的代码,并添加了问题的截图。

试试这个…

$j("a.fancybox").fancybox({
    onComplete: function() {
        $('#fancybox-outer').css('opacity', '0.4');
    }
});

…或…

#fancybox-outer {
    opacity: .4 !important;
}